Mission:

Prepare for the community at-large creative and unique liturgical celebrations of the sacraments that inspire individuals to live their lives as exemplified by Jesus.

Objectives:

  • At monthly meetings plan the major liturgical seasons and events including:
    · Provide vehicle/tool to help the community focus on the theme through prayer at Liturgy
    · Provide a vehicle/tool to bring message into homes (e.g. Advent inserts)
    · Focus on diversity
    · Preserve the importance of ritual/understanding/traditions and various cultures, (e.g. bread on Holy Thursday, daffodils on Good Friday, Servants’ Sign on back wall, banner.)
    · Commit ourselves to personal spiritual growth and communal worship, (e.g. Holy Week Readings, Little Black Books, Communion Meditations, Month of Remembering with Offertory Litany of Remembering.)

  • Take advantage of special enrichment programs and resources for the members.

  • Communicate and work as needed with other ministries.

  • Measure and evaluate our resources and the effectiveness of our ministry in light of our St. John Fisher Mission and Vision.
